Frugal Friday’s Workwear Report: Stretch-Cotton Short-Sleeve Tee

Our daily workwear reports suggest one piece of work-appropriate attire in a range of prices.

This T-shirt from Theory was a reader favorite around 2010, and I’m delighted to see that it’s still available. (H/t to Kat for finding this one!)

For those of you who didn’t have this in your closet 12 years ago, it’s one of the all-time greats for wearing under suits. It’s 94% cotton, 6% spandex, so it’s wonderfully soft, but it still has just a touch of stretch. I also find that the scoop-neck is incredibly flattering without being too revealing.

The top is $29.25 at the Theory outlet and comes in sizes P–L. In addition to black, it comes in white, medium heather, and deep navy.
